A transesophageal echocardiogram (TEE; also spelled transoesophageal echocardiogram; TOE in British English) is an alternative way to perform an echocardiogram. A specialized probe containing an ultrasound transducer at its tip is passed into the patient's esophagus. [1] This allows image and Doppler evaluation which can be recorded. It is ...
A transthoracic echocardiogram (TTE) is the most common type of echocardiogram, which is a still or moving image of the internal parts of the heart using ultrasound. In this case, the probe (or ultrasonic transducer ) is placed on the chest or abdomen of the subject to get various views of the heart.

Doppler echocardiography is a procedure that uses Doppler ultrasonography to examine the heart. [1] An echocardiogram uses high frequency sound waves to create an image of the heart while the use of Doppler technology allows determination of the speed and direction of blood flow by utilizing the Doppler effect .

Left ventricular mass or LVM refers to the mass of the left ventricle of the heart.. Left ventricular mass index or LVMi is LVM divided by body surface area.. LVM is usually estimated using linear measurements obtained from echocardiography, [1] but can also be calculated using CT or MRI images. [2]
